Horizon Bancorp Executive Compensation (FY25)

HBNC · Executive and director compensation, fiscal 2023 to 2025
Data as of September 5, 2026Latest filing (8-K): May 8, 2026
242 figures on this page: 231 cited to the filing that reported them, 11 calculated from figures it prints. See the citations
Thomas Prame, President and Chief Executive Officer, received $1,965,115 in total compensation for fiscal 2025, and compared with the $1,640,847 reported for fiscal 2024, Prame's total was 19.8% higher. For fiscal 2025, the company reported a chief executive pay ratio of 38.7:1, against median employee compensation of $50,839. The say-on-pay proposal drew 97.0% of votes cast for or against in favor at the meeting held May 7, 2026 for fiscal 2025. The disclosed peer group names Byline Bancorp, City Holding Company, Community Trust Bancorp, Farmers National Banc Corp. and First Busey Corporation, among others.
